1. What is the Wavelength Formula?

The wavelength formula calculates the distance between consecutive crests of a wave, typically represented by the Greek letter lambda (λ). In the context of electromagnetic waves, it relates the speed of light to frequency.

2. How Does the Calculator Work?

The calculator uses the wavelength formula:

\[ \lambda = \frac{c}{f} \]

Where:

Explanation: The formula shows that wavelength is inversely proportional to frequency - higher frequency waves have shorter wavelengths.

3. Importance of Wavelength Calculation

Details: Calculating wavelength is fundamental in physics, particularly in optics, electromagnetism, and wave mechanics. It's essential for understanding light behavior, designing communication systems, and studying wave phenomena.

5. Frequently Asked Questions (FAQ)

Q1: What is the speed of light in different media?
A: The speed of light is approximately 3×10^8 m/s in vacuum, but slows down in other media like water (2.25×10^8 m/s) or glass (2×10^8 m/s).

Q2: How does wavelength relate to energy?
A: Shorter wavelengths correspond to higher energy photons according to the formula E = hc/λ, where h is Planck's constant.

Q3: What are typical wavelength ranges?
A: Radio waves can be kilometers long, visible light is 380-750 nanometers, and gamma rays have wavelengths smaller than atoms.

Q4: Why does wavelength matter in communication?
A: Different wavelengths propagate differently through space and materials, affecting signal range, penetration, and interference.

Q5: How is wavelength measured experimentally?
A: Common methods include interference patterns (Young's double slit), diffraction gratings, or using known frequency sources.
